What is an MSG File?

Microsoft Outlook and Exchange employ the MSG file format (.msg) to store individual emails, appointments, contacts, tasks, or calendar entries.

Method 1: Drag and Drop MSG Files into Office 365 

This method is appropriate for users if they have a few MSG files that they want to convert. For this users need the MS Outlook for desktop.

  1. Install and launch MS Outlook on the device.
  2. Move to the folder where the MSG files are stored in the computer.
  3. Select the MSG files to import to Outlook.
  4. Press and hold the chosen files, then drag them to an open folder inside Microsoft Outlook.
  5. Let go of the mouse button,to drop the files into the selected folder.  

Method 2: Copy and Paste Approach to Transfer MSG Files to Office 365

To import MSG into Office 365, users can choose to use the Copy & Paste option:

  1. Go to the folder on your computer where the MSG files are stored.
  2. Choose the MSG files to bring to Outlook.
  3. Right-click the chosen files and select Copy, or just press Ctrl+C.
  4. Next, open Microsoft Outlook and choose the folder where users want the emails to appear.
  5. Right-click in that folder and select Paste, or press Ctrl + V.

Things to Consider Before Choosing the Manual Methods

Before a user chooses to rely fully on manual approaches, here are a few key points they should be aware of:

  • Initially, manual steps may seem easy, but they often fail for bulk or organized imports.
  • Outlook distorts the original folder formatting during drag-and-drop.
  • Some emails may lose crucial credentials like date, category, or attachments.
  • Users need to have Outlook installed and configured to use the manual methods.
  • Chances to filter files or skip duplicates while importing are scarce.

Users handling a few files, the manual way can be considered. But for batch imports or business use, the approaches are risky due to the above mentioned drawbacks. Hence, users prefer to move to the automated solution.
